It may also be that the price submitted to HGVC for ROFR may not have been $4,000. If the eBay seller was one of the companies that charge desperate sellers a big upfront fee, the price submitted for ROFR may have actually been your $4K contract price plus the upfront fee, which could have easily been $2500 to $3000. I have read that some of those companies structure their submittals that way and is the reason some appear to pass at lower prices than you would think likely.
